    Ezekiel Lau wins stop four of Hard Rock Cafe Surf Series
     




    Stop #4 of Hard Rock Cafe Surf Series
    Presented by the Hawaii Surfing Association

    HSA
    Rennicks Oahu, Hawaii
    15 - 16 November 2008

    Ezekiel Lau Breaks Victory Drought to Win Stop #4 of Hard Rock Cafe Surf Series, Hawaii

    Surfersvillage Global Surf News, 17 November, 2008 : - - Honolulu -- Ezekiel Lau, 14, of Honolulu, has won stop #4 of the Hard Rock Cafe Surf Series, presented by the Hawaii Surfing Association, to finally break out of a victory drought that spanned 'forever' and qualify for the State Championships.

    Surfing at Rennicks this weekend, Lau found himself in a winning groove at his home break to outpoint fellow juniors Kylen Yamakawa, Matty Costa and Buddy Wiggins in 2-foot surf. "I just kept busy, caught every little wave around and tried to get lucky," said Lau about his heat strategy. "I haven't won a contest in forever. It feels great."

    Lau boosted tail-free turns and airs without hesitation in the final. He opened  up the heat with an 8-point ride out of a possible 10. The Kamehameha School freshmen also surfed with out a leash in the final, allowing him to surf faster in the small waves. "I usually don't surf out here with a leash anyways and it's tiny," Lau said. "You go faster because there's less drag."

    Surfing leash-less helped Lau surf with speed, but it also hindered him in the final. After dominating the whole heat, Lau had an opportunity to solidify his victory on a fast, right breaking wave in the last few minutes. The regular foot was setting up for a huge aerial maneuver when he accidentally caught a rail, fell and lost his board.

    "I just did a little check turn off the top and when I came off the bottom I saw the line just stretch," said Lau of his last ride. "I was just going to pump and do a fat air, but I don't know. I think my back foot slipped off. Sickening. Then I lost my board."

    Lau was left  standing on the shallow reef, wondering if he just threw away a win. As he swam for his board, the horn blew to end the heat. "I thought that would seal the deal right there," said Lau about his last wave in the final. "I saw Kylen get two good ones so I thought I blew it." Luckily for Lau, his previous two waves, an 8 and a 6, were enough to capture the win.

    "This is only my second [HSA] contest [this year]," Lau said. "I only did the two events that were here so I think this bumped me up so I made States."

    RESULTS Surfers listed in order of 1st through 4th

    SHORTBOARD:
    Junior Men: Ezekiel Lau; Kylen Yamakawa; Matty Costa; Buddy Wiggins
    Men: Davin Jaime; Scott Saito
    Menehune 1-A: Finn McGill; Michael Ikalani; Christopher Bluhardt; Klaus Eyre
    Menehune 2-A: Seth Moniz; Kaulana Apo;  Elijah Gates; Kalani David
    Boys: Isiah Moniz; Coley Yamakawa; Kaito Kino; Josh Moniz
    Master: Brice Yamashita; Thomas Spear; Alessandro Costa; Bruce Foley
    Senior Men: Shannon Silva; Sheldon Poirier; Stephen O'Brien; Hank Hundhausen
    Grandmaster: Kal Faurot; Raymond Shito; Gilbert Perea; Beau Hodges
    Open Men: Matty Costa; Davin Jaime; Matthew Oshiro; Thomas Spear
    Girls: Kallee Krebs; Dax McGill; Maile Enos Branigan; Nicole Brueffemann
    Women: bonnie Campanella; Izumi Baldwin; Mari Sullivan; Susan Nishida

    BODYBOARD:
    Bodyboard Boys: Micah Liana
    Bodyboard Men: James Clancy; Mark Gervacaio
    Drop Knee: James Clancy; Mark Gervacio

    LONGBOARD:
    Menehune Longboard: Micah Liana; Jordan Brueggemann; Klans Eyre; Vincent Starn
    Junior Longboard: Nelson Ahina
    Men Longboard: Justin Mitsui; Mau Ah Hee; Daniel Teijeiro
    Senior Men Longboard:  Alika Willis; Gino Bell; Frederico Algono; Gavin Hasegawa
    Girls Longboard: Tracy Pruse; Kelly Graf; Keisha Eyre; Bailey Nagy
    Women Longboard: Izumi Baldwin; Dana Tortuga
    Legends Longboard: Layton Sun; Lance Ohata; George Matsuda; Wink Arnott
    Open Longboard: Nelson Ahina; Mau Ah Hee; Daniel Teijeiro; Gino Bell

    STAND-UP PADDLE:
    Nelson Ahina; Chris Martin; Alika Willis; Micah Liana
